Why Does Reality Hit You So Hard?
Understanding the Context
Reality often catches us off guard because it shatters comfort zones. Our brains crave predictability and control, but life delivers surprises that challenge our assumptions. When reality crashes—like an unexpected career shift, a failed relationship, or a long-held belief shaken—the emotional impact is intense. These moments feel real, unignorable, and deeply personal. That urgency to process what happened fuels endless mental replay.
The Psychology Behind Obsessive Replay
Psychologists explain that repeated thinking about a tense moment—often called “rumination”—serves a function. It’s your brain’s attempt to make sense of confusing, painful, or transformative experiences. Through rehearsal, you try to extract lessons, validate your feelings, or find closure. While excessive rumination can be draining, it’s a sign your mind is actively engaged with meaning. Understanding this can help turn frustration into a tool for growth.
Common Triggers for Replay Moments

- Emotional Arousal: Moments charged with strong feelings—surprise, anger, joy, sorrow—stay top of mind longer.
- Unresolved Tension: Unfinished business, open questions, or unresolved conflict encourage repetitive thinking.
- Life-Changing Shifts: Promotions, losses, or major decisions ripple through identity and routine, demanding reflection.
- Narrative Focus: Some people are naturally introspective, tuning into their internal stories more deeply than others.
How to Manage the Cycle of Replay
While replaying crucial moments isn’t always avoidable, you can cultivate healthier ways to engage with them:
- Acknowledge the Feeling – Recognize that what you’re experiencing is normal and meaningful.
2. Set a Time Limit – Give yourself a “thinking window” to process—then redirect energy into action or new experiences.
3. Reframe the Narrative – Ask, “What can I learn here?” or “How has this shaped me?”
4. Seek Perspective – Talk to a trusted friend or therapist to gain fresh insight and reduce mental loops.
